What is Berserk?

Before we get into the specifics of the 2022 anime, let's take a quick look at what makes Berserk so special. Berserk, created by Kentaro Miura, is set in a dark medieval world filled with demons, war, and political intrigue. The story revolves around Guts, a lone mercenary with a tragic past, and Griffith, the charismatic leader of the Band of the Hawk. Their intertwined destinies drive the narrative, exploring themes of friendship, betrayal, fate, and the struggle against overwhelming darkness.

Berserk is renowned for its incredibly detailed artwork, particularly Miura's depiction of battles and monsters. The story's depth and complexity have earned it a devoted following, solidifying its place as one of the greatest manga series ever created.
